Today, 27 April 2026, during the audience granted to His Most Reverend Eminence Cardinal Marcello Semeraro, Prefect of the Dicastery for the Causes of Saints, Pope Leo XIV authorised the said Dicastery to promulgate a number of decrees, including one recognising the heroic virtues of the Servant of God Maria Teresa of the Most Holy Trinity (born Teresa Ysseldijk), a professed nun of the Congregation of the Carmelite Sisters of the Divine Heart of Jesus, born on 13 November 1897 in Apeldoorn (Netherlands) and died on 10 March 1926 in St. Louis (United States of America).
